The Opportunity:

The CIS program supports our intelligence customer deliver IT services to conduct its globally distributed operations. We are driving an exciting technological transformation of customer IT services by leading the design, development, implementation, and operation of cutting-edge solutions. This includes continuous service improvement through the modernization of IT system infrastructure.

CACI is looking for an experienced, innovative, and motivated Endpoint Systems Lead to support the mission objectives and needs of the customer, the Defense Intelligence Agency.  The position is contingent upon award of the DIA SITE III CIO Infrastructure Services (CIS) contract.

 Responsibilities:

Leadership & Strategic Oversight:

  • Direct global, 24/7 IT operations and manage technical teams providing comprehensive support for enterprise infrastructure, devices, and endpoint solutions.

  • Serve as the IT/IS Business Manager, collaborating directly with Engineering teams and customer stakeholders to define requirements and ensure availability, reliability, and operability objectives are met.

  • Lead Continual Service Improvement (CSI) and innovation initiatives, researching emerging technologies and articulating the strategic benefits of infrastructure evolution to executive stakeholders.

  • Manage the transition of engineered solutions from Engineering teams through Beta/Acceptance testing and Blue/Green fielding utilizing dedicated Lab facilities.

Endpoint & Infrastructure Management:

  • Oversee the deployment, operation, and maintenance of physical, virtual, and cloud-based desktop and mobile endpoints across Citrix, Azure, AWS, and VMware infrastructures.

  • Manage enterprise desktop and application packaging, directing the use of Microsoft Endpoint Configuration Manager (MECM) and Intune for remote distribution to thick, thin, virtual, and mobile devices.

  • Direct end-user profile management strategies, ensuring automated updates and synchronization with Active Directory to optimize startup, login, application streaming, and overall user experience.

  • Coordinate Tier 3 engineering resources and cross-functional teams for advanced troubleshooting, problem resolution, and scheduled/ad hoc maintenance activities.

Security, Compliance & Administration:

  • Orchestrate continuous patch management and vulnerability mitigation for workstations and servers across all networks and security domains in strict accordance with contract requirements.

  • Ensure endpoint security and compliance by overseeing the configuration of hardware BIOS, device drivers, and full disk encryption utilizing NIST-, FIPS-, and NSA-approved algorithms.

  • Govern all hardware and software licensing, distribution, and accounting by user account, device, and group to ensure compliance and cost efficiency.

  • Manage the creation and delivery of required contract documentation,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s), reports, and data, and oversee approved Plan of Action and Milestones (POA&M).

  • Qualifications:

Required: 

  • Must hold a current Top Secret SCI clearance with ability to obtain poly prior to start

  • Experience leading people or projects

  • Microsoft 365 Certified: Endpoint Administrator Associate (40+ hrs. training) and/or 7 years of experience

  • Red Hat Certified System Administrator (RHCSA), Citrix Certified Associate-Virtualization, Azure Fundamentals, OEM equivalent, VMware Certified Advanced Professional – Data Center Virtualization Design, OR Azure Administrator

  • DOD 8140 Certification applicable to role (minimum Security+)

  • An AA and 14+ years of experience, BS/BA and 12+ years of experience, MS/MA and 10+ years of experience, or PhD and 8+ years of experience

  • Minimum 6 years of hands-on experience integrating, operating, and maintaining IT hardware and software solutions

  • Willingness to learn new skills and new technologies.

Desired: 

  • Degree in Science, Technology, or Engineering

  • Experience leading a distributed technical team

  • Ivanti User Workspace Administrator

  • Familiarity with IC ITE services and classified environments

  • ITIL 4 Foundation Certification
